> On Wed, 2005-08-17 at 12:37, Jeremy Hylton wrote:
> > I'd like to see the builtin id() removed so that I can use it as a
> > local variable name without clashing with the builtin name.  I
> > certainly use the id() function, but not as often as I have a local
> > variable I'd like to name id.
> 
> Same here.
> 
> > The sys module seems like a natural
> > place to put id(), since it is exposing something about the
> > implementation of Python rather than something about the language; the
> > language offers the is operator to check ids.
